The Importance of Regularly Updating Your System Software
Introduction
Regularly updating your system software is critical for maintaining the security and performance of your Windows PC. This article highlights the importance of these updates.
1. Enhancing Security
Software updates often include security patches that protect your system from vulnerabilities and potential cyber threats.
Common Security Updates
These updates address known security issues and help protect against malware and ransomware attacks.
2. Improving Performance
Updates can also improve the performance of your system by fixing bugs and optimizing resource management.
Performance Enhancements
Many updates come with optimizations that can lead to faster loading times and improved responsiveness.
3. New Features and Functionality
System updates may introduce new features that enhance user experience and productivity.
Exploring New Features
After an update, take time to explore any new functionalities that can make your work easier.
4. Compatibility Upgrades
Regular updates ensure your system remains compatible with the latest software and hardware components.
Staying Current
This is particularly important for users who wish to run the latest applications or games.
Conclusion
Staying on top of system updates is essential for a secure and efficient Windows experience. Make it a habit to check for updates regularly to reap the benefits.
